Why Choose a Submersible Pump for Your RV

Traditional RVs typically come standard with external diaphragm pumps, but these units are notorious for their loud, rattling vibrations that echo through thin interior walls. Submersible pumps solve this problem at the source by utilizing the surrounding water in your tank as a natural acoustic insulator. This results in an incredibly peaceful cabin environment, allowing you to run the water late at night without waking up everyone in the rig.

Beyond noise reduction, submersible pumps are incredibly space-efficient because they sit entirely inside your freshwater tank. This frees up valuable cabinet or storage space that would otherwise be occupied by a bulky external pump and its associated accumulator tank. In tiny homes and van conversions, saving even a few square inches of storage space can make a massive difference in daily comfort.

Finally, submersible pumps are inherently self-priming because they are constantly gravity-fed and surrounded by liquid. This eliminates the frustrating air-lock issues that often plague external pumps when a tank runs dry. While they require careful electrical connections inside the tank, their mechanical simplicity often translates to fewer failure points in your overall plumbing system.

Key Features to Check Before Buying

Before purchasing any submersible pump, measuring the physical dimensions of your freshwater tank’s opening is absolutely crucial. A pump with incredible specs is useless if it cannot physically pass through the screw cap or cleanout port of your water container. Always compare the maximum outer diameter of the pump against the narrowest restriction of your tank inlet.

Next, pay close attention to the pump’s pressure rating, usually measured in bar or PSI, and its overall flow rate. If you plan to install an inline water filter or a tankless water heater, you will need a high-pressure pump to push water through these restrictive appliances. Here are key technical specifications to compare before making a final decision:

  • Flow Rate (GPM/LPM): Determines how fast water exits the tap and matches your daily usage needs.
  • Maximum Lift Height: The vertical distance the pump can push water upward from the bottom of the tank.
  • Amperage Draw: The amount of electrical current the pump pulls from your 12V battery system during operation.
  • Run-Dry Protection: Determines whether the pump’s motor will burn out if the water tank empties completely.

Lastly, evaluate the power connection and wire length provided with the pump. Because these units operate underwater, splicing wires inside or directly above the tank requires completely waterproof heat-shrink tubing and marine-grade connectors. Opting for a pump with a longer pre-installed cable can make this critical installation step much safer and far less tedious.

Step-by-Step Submersible Installation

Installing a submersible pump is a highly manageable DIY project, provided you approach the electrical work with precision and patience. Begin by thoroughly cleaning your freshwater tank to prevent any construction debris from clogging your brand-new pump’s inlet screen. Next, measure the depth of your tank and cut your food-grade water delivery hose to a length that allows the pump to sit flat on the bottom of the tank without kinking.

Once the plumbing hose is securely clamped to the pump’s outlet barb using marine-grade stainless steel hose clamps, thread the power cables and hose through your tank lid. Use a waterproof cable gland or a tight-fitting rubber grommet on the tank lid to create a sanitary, leak-proof seal. This simple barrier prevents dust, pests, and ambient contaminants from entering your clean drinking water supply.

For the electrical connection, join the pump’s wires to your RV‚Äôs 12V switch panel using adhesive-lined heat shrink butt connectors to guarantee a completely watertight seal. Connect the pump to a dedicated fuse and a manual switch or a pressure-activated switch if you want automatic faucet operation. Run a brief test cycle with clean water to check for leaks and confirm that the pump is spinning in the correct direction.

Crucial Maintenance Tips for Longevity

Though submersible pumps are generally low-maintenance, a few simple habits will dramatically extend their operational lifespan. Never let your submersible pump run dry for extended periods, as the surrounding water acts as both a lubricant and a cooling agent for the internal motor. Running a pump dry causes rapid heat buildup, which can melt internal seals and lead to permanent motor failure.

Regularly inspect and clean the pump’s intake screen, especially if you occasionally source water from rustic forest service spigots or natural springs. Tiny sediment particles, sand, and mineral scale can clog the impeller, forcing the motor to work harder and draw more electricity. A quick flush with a diluted white vinegar solution once or twice a year will easily dissolve stubborn hard water deposits.

When preparing your RV for freezing winter temperatures, completely drain the pump and the lines to prevent ice from cracking the housing. If you store your rig in freezing climates, submerge the pump in a small container of non-toxic RV antifreeze or remove it entirely from the tank to store it in a temperature-controlled space. Taking these preventative steps ensures your water system is ready to perform reliably the moment spring arrives.

Frequently Asked Questions (FAQs)

What is a submersible RV water pump for fresh water?

A submersible RV water pump is a compact 12-volt motorized device placed directly inside an RV fresh water holding tank to push water out to faucets and fixtures. Because the motor sits underwater, the surrounding liquid naturally dampens operating noise and cools the internal components. These pumps operate on centrifugal pressure and are common in European-style camper vans and compact travel trailers where cabinet space is extremely limited.

What does the flow rate mean on a 12V submersible RV water pump?

Flow rate measures the volume of fresh water a submersible RV pump delivers to your plumbing fixtures per minute, expressed in gallons or liters. Most 12-volt submersible models deliver between 2.5 and 4.5 gallons per minute (GPM) at pressures between 15 and 25 PSI. A higher flow rate allows you to run multiple taps simultaneously, while lower-flow units conserve precious tank reserves during off-grid dry camping trips.

How do I install a submersible RV water pump in a fresh water holding tank?

Install a submersible RV water pump by lowering the pump body through the tank inspection hatch until it rests near the bottom, then connecting the hose and wiring. Secure food-grade flexible vinyl tubing to the pump outlet using a marine-grade stainless steel hose clamp. Next, splice the positive and negative 12V DC power leads using heat-shrink butt connectors to prevent water intrusion. Test the circuit by opening a faucet switch before resealing the tank access port.

How do you sanitize an RV fresh water system with a submersible pump?

Sanitize an RV fresh water system using a diluted bleach solution mixed at one-quarter cup of regular unscented household bleach per fifteen gallons of water. Pour the solution into the tank, run the submersible pump until bleach odor reaches every faucet, and let the system sit for four hours. Drain the holding tank completely, refill it with clean potable water, and flush all fixtures until the chlorine smell disappears. Avoid letting concentrated chemicals sit directly on plastic impellers.

Is a submersible RV water pump better than an inline diaphragm pump?

Compared to inline diaphragm pumps, submersible RV water pumps are quieter and require less interior space, though they produce lower pressure. Inline diaphragm pumps push water at 45 to 55 PSI and self-prime from outside the tank, making maintenance simpler. Conversely, submerged centrifugal pumps operate virtually silently at 15 to 25 PSI, making them preferable for light campers where noisy pump vibration disrupts sleep. Choose inline models if high shower pressure is your top priority.

How many amps does a 12V submersible RV fresh water pump draw?

Most 12V submersible RV fresh water pumps draw between 1.5 and 4.5 amps of direct current under standard operating load. Compact models rated around 2.5 gallons per minute typically consume roughly 25 to 45 watts when active. Running the pump for an aggregate total of 20 minutes a day will consume less than two amp-hours from your auxiliary RV battery bank, making these pumps highly efficient for boondocking setups.

Why is my submersible RV fresh water pump running continuously without building pressure?

Continuous running without pressure usually indicates an airlock inside the pump housing, a blown internal check valve, or an empty fresh water tank. Air bubbles trapped around the centrifugal impeller prevent the pump from pushing liquid through the lines. To clear an airlock, gently shake the submerged unit or turn the power switch off and on rapidly while a faucet is fully open. Also inspect the intake screen for sediment clogs that starve the impeller.

Is it safe to leave a submersible RV water pump submerged in freezing winter weather?

Leaving a submersible RV water pump in a fresh water tank during freezing weather will crack the plastic housing and destroy internal seals. Expanding ice bursts the plastic impeller casing and ruptures motor seals. Before sub-freezing temperatures arrive, disconnect the plumbing, lift the pump out of the tank, shake out residual water, and store the unit indoors. Alternatively, bypass the tank and pump non-toxic RV antifreeze through the supply lines.
